1. Benefits of Dental Implants Explained

Dental implants serve as a long-term solution for tooth loss, offering unparalleled benefits that go beyond aesthetics. First and foremost, they restore functionality, allowing individuals to eat, speak, and smile without concern. Unlike dentures, which can shift or slip, implants fuse with the jawbone, providing a stable and natural-feeling replacement.
Moreover, dental implants positively impact oral health. With traditional tooth loss solutions, adjacent teeth may shift, leading to further complications. Implants help maintain the structure of the mouth and prevent bone loss, ensuring that the facial profile remains intact over time.
Additionally, having a complete set of teeth contributes significantly to self-esteem and confidence. Patients often report an increase in social interactions and a willingness to smile openly once they have received dental implants, highlighting their importance in overall psychological well-being.
2. Understanding the Dental Implant Procedure
The dental implant process is generally straightforward yet involves several key steps. Initially, a thorough dental examination is performed, which may include X-rays and 3D imagery to evaluate the jaws condition. This critical first step helps in determining the most suitable treatment plan for each patient.
Following the initial assessment, the implantation process begins. Dentists place the titanium post into the jawbone, acting as a replacement root. Over a period of months, this post integrates with the bone, a process known as osseointegration. During this time, patients may receive temporary restorations to maintain functionality until healing is complete.
The final phase involves placing the custom-made crown on the implant. This restoration is crafted to match the color and shape of existing teeth, ensuring a seamless appearance. Regular follow-ups ensure everything is functioning correctly and that the healing process is on track.
3. Potential Risks and Considerations of Implants
While dental implants are widely considered safe, potential risks must be acknowledged. One of the primary concerns is the possibility of infection at the implant site. Patients are encouraged to maintain good oral hygiene and follow the dentists aftercare instructions diligently to reduce this risk.
Another critical consideration is the adequacy of the jawbone. Patients with significant bone loss may require grafting procedures before implants can be placed. This adds time and complexity to the overall treatment process but is often necessary to ensure successful implantation.
It’s also essential for prospective patients to discuss their complete medical history with their dentist. Certain health conditions and medications can impact the implant process, so full disclosure helps tailor the approach to the individuals needs.
4. Essential Aftercare for Dental Implants
Aftercare following dental implant surgery plays a crucial role in ensuring the long-term success of the treatment. The first few days post-surgery are critical; patients are advised to follow dietary restrictions and manage discomfort with recommended pain relievers. Soft foods, hydration, and avoiding strenuous activities are key during recovery.
Maintaining proper oral hygiene is vital. Patients should continue to brush and floss regularly, focusing on the implant site to prevent plaque buildup. Regular dental check-ups allow the dentist to monitor the implants health and address any concerns before they escalate.
Lastly, lifestyle choices can greatly impact the longevity of dental implants. Patients are encouraged to avoid tobacco products, which can interfere with healing and increase the risk of complications. Staying active, eating a balanced diet, and managing stress levels can also contribute to overall oral health.
